## Sensor drift: what to do at 3am

If the GrowLoop controller starts reporting humidity swings that don't match the backup probes in the Fernwick greenhouse, it's almost always sensor drift, not an actual climate event. Don't panic and don't touch the vents manually. First, restart the calibration daemon and give it ten minutes to re-baseline. If readings still disagree by more than 5%, flip the controller into safe mode. The safe-mode thresholds it will use are these.

config for yahap-bajof:
[istix]
host = istix.qorvelsys.internal
user = istix_svc
database = istix_prod

### Step 4: Handle flaky integration tests

The Coinshed payments suite occasionally fails on settlement-timing tests. Retry once; do not skip. Two consecutive failures block the release — escalate, don't override. Flake history is tracked in the test ledger for audit. Once the suite is green, sign the release manifest using the deploy key shown below.

signing key of yajog-kafof = bky19_orbYRY3Abj3KpZesMie

As release manager, you coordinate the staged rollout of the Amberline consent banner across all Fernwood Digital properties. Rollout proceeds in three rings: internal, 5% of traffic, then full. Each ring requires sign-off from Legal Review and a 48-hour soak with no spike in consent-API errors. Feature flags live in the Lattice console; never promote a ring on a Friday. The banner copy is frozen per regulatory guidance. For flag access or legal sign-off questions, write to the address below.

alerts address for kajog-tadup: druox@plorvanet.internal